Placement A wall-mounted electric fireplace can turn any room into a cozy retreat. While traditional wood-burning fireplaces require a chimney, flue and vent, these modern units are designed to hang on the wall and plug into a standard electrical outlet to allow for simple set up. These modern units are also less expensive than traditional ones which makes them a great alternative for apartment dwellers and homeowners on a tight budget. In contrast to wood and gas fireplaces that produce smoke that stain the walls and furniture, modern electric fireplaces emit no odors or stain. Electric fireplaces are a great alternative to traditional wood-burning places. They can be used for supplementary heating for rooms as large as 1,000 square feet. Check the BTU rating of your electric fireplace, whether it is recessed or freestanding. A wall mount recessed fireplace can add a touch of elegance to any room. The mantel is a part of an electric wall mounted fireplace that is situated directly over the fire. It is typically constructed of wood or other materials. Some people prefer to install floating mantels that hang from the bottom of the fireplace while others prefer a traditional one that extends all the way to the top of the firebox.
